[Bug 34582] Re: right clicking switches page direction.

2008-07-24 Thread Robert Pollak
As a small improvement (less surprise for inexperienced users), one can disable bidirectional text: 1) Type about:config into the address bar. 2) In the Filter: text box, type bidi 3) The bidi.browser.ui entry was set to true in the value column. To change it to false, right-click on this entry
